Installation and wiring
Before connecting the flow sensor to the dosing controller 8025 Batch, in a panel-mounted or a wall-
mounted version:
Set selector "SENSOR TYPE" depending on the output signal originating from the flow sensor. See
“Figure 29” and “Table 5”, page 40.
• If selector "SENSOR TYPE" is set on "NPN/PNP", set selector "SENSOR SUPPLY" depending on the
dosing controller supply voltage. See “Figure 30” and “Table 5”, page 40.
Set selector "LOAD" depending on the type of signal sent out by the flow sensor and on the load
wanted on terminal 1 "PULSE INPUT" of terminal block "FLOW SENSOR". See “Table 5”, page 40.
Selector
C
makes it possible to configure the type of signal the 8025 Batch, panel- or wall-mounted version,
receives from the remote flow sensor.
Set the selector on the right (default position) when
the signal from the flow sensor which is connected to
the 8025 Batch is either:
• a pulse signal, NPN or PNP
• an "on/off" signal (Reed relay for example)
• a 0-5 V DC standard voltage signal (TTL, for example)
Set the selector on the left when the
signal from the flow sensor which is
connected to the 8025 Batch is a sine-
wave signal (coil).

When selector "SENSOR TYPE" above
is set on "NPN/PNP", selector
A
makes it possible to configure the supply
voltage for the remote flow sensor.

If the device is energized with a 115/230 V AC power supply, set
selector "SENSOR SUPPLY" on "L+" (default position).
If the device is energized with a 12-36 V DC power supply, set
the voltage selector "SENSOR SUPPLY" depending on the
voltage supply needed by the remote flow sensor: "+5V", "L+" or
"(L+)-12V" (default position).
